Goal: an LLM or script can migrate an entire legacy database using only
the HTTP API - original history preserved, safely re-runnable.

- X-Import-Mode header (admin only): create/update endpoints across 15
  timestamped entity types accept original createddate/modifieddate;
  helper exposed via shopdb.api (contract 0.7.0 -> 0.8.0).
- Exact-match natural-key lookup filters on 13 list endpoints for the
  lookup-then-upsert recipe.
- Selfhosted USB checkout/checkin accept backdated event times in
  import mode.
- docs/IMPORT-API.md: operator manual grounded in the real legacy
  schema - order of operations, full table-by-table mapping including
  the machines fan-out, idempotent Python importer with dry-run, parity
  checks, and decided dispositions for unmigrated tables (DNC config
  stays live-fed via the collector; supportteams/appowners map to the
  upcoming supportteams model).

635 tests pass; naming green; frontend untouched.
